Another unusual sea creature spotted in Puget Sound



Some very unusual sea creatures have been spotted visiting the waters of Puget Sound including an ocean sunfish, called a Mola Mola.

Mola Molas can grow to 11 feet long, weigh more than a ton, and they eat jellyfish.

Jonah Zimmerman got a shot of the big fish swimming near his boat not far from Tacoma.

These fish are rarely seen in our waters because they are warm-water fish but researchers at the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ration said a marine heat wave has been warming up West Coast waters enough that new species are following the things they eat all the way here.
